Have done months of lurking on here, looking at every option possibly available to me. None were quite what I'm looking for (plug and play lci style lights and sub 1k)
Used OEM - not plug and play Spyder and various copies - no, those christmas light angel eyes looked a bit too tacky Protuninglab - better looking angel eyes, but the styling is just a bit too aftermarket-y Umnitza bixenon- these are just repackaged depos Depos - we all know those lci style headlights aren't gonna drop for another 5 years So this just leaves me with the various aliexpress headlights that have come out in the last few months. Reviews on them here are close to nonexistent. The pictures and videos of them show a stellar angel eye lci pattern, but I have no idea how well the actual low/hi beams are. I'm guessing they aren't very good. But it's time boys, to set aside my analysis paralysis. I'm getting them, and will provide my own personal review after the month it takes to get here. And secretly hoping someone on here has already done the install and will respond with their review... But I'm not hopeful of that. Wish me luck! https://m.aliexpress.com/item/4001340425074.html |

I've bitten the bullet with respect to aftermarket LED headlights from AliExpress almost 6 months ago, and documented it in this thread. Upside is that the ballast modules are plug and play. Coming from Xenon headlights, lighting pattern is top notch and is substantially brighter than Xenons. Make sure you buy what you were looking for (Bi-xenon, or LEDs).
Micro Cracks F30 Xenon adaptive These are the LED headlights I picked up, along with a short review |
